Recent Form Insights: Aaron Rai
- Rai has made the cut four times in a row and will look to continue his streak this week.
- Rai has made the weekend and finished in the top 20 on the leaderboard once in his past four tournaments.
- Rai finished with a better-than-average score in two of his past four tournaments.
- In his past four tournaments, his average score was -4.
- Over his last 16 rounds, Rai has finished below par nine times, while also carding one bogey-free round and 11 rounds with a better-than-average score.
- He has recorded a top-10 score once in his last 16 rounds.

Last Time Out
- Rai was relatively average over the 20 par-3 holes at the RBC Canadian Open, averaging par to finish in the 58th percentile of the field.
- He averaged 4.00 strokes on par-4 holes (of which there were 40) at the RBC Canadian Open, which was strong enough to place him in the 83rd percentile of the field on par 4s (the tournament average was 4.08 strokes).
- Rai was better than 87% of the competitors at the RBC Canadian Open on par-5 holes, averaging 4.33 strokes per hole, compared to the field average of 4.63 strokes.
- Rai shot the same as the field average on par-3 holes in his most recent appearance, carding a birdie or better on two of the 20 par-3 holes at the RBC Canadian Open.
- On the 20 par-3 holes at the RBC Canadian Open, Rai recorded two bogeys or worse (the field averaged 2.6).
- Rai’s eight birdies or better on par-4 holes at the RBC Canadian Open were more than the field average (4.4).
